My Favorite Things To Do in 📍Paris

Paris is my favorite city to visit and there are so many things to do, especially in the summer so here are my personal recommendations.

🥂Happy Hour or Dinner at an Outdoor Restaurant

The French love to sit outside and eat over a 2-3 hour meal and I think it’s the perfect way to take in the city, especially if you have a great view.

🏰 Castle or Museum Visit

Paris has so much unique history to share with the world and I love seeing how grand the castles are. My favorite is the Castle of Versailles (not pictured). It is 30 mins outside of the city but it’s worth the trek.

🧺 Picnic at the Eiffel Tower

The Eiffel Tower is a great way to wind down at the end of the night, especially because it is lit for the first 10 mins of every hour starting at 10PM. Vendors sell wine and mini charcueterie boards and it is one of my favorite things go do in the summer evenings.
